The National Weather Service (NWS) issued a Red Flag Warning for most of Los Angeles and Ventura Counties from Thursday evening through Sunday due to windy and low humidity weather conditions.

The warning will be in effect from 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 20 to 6 p.m. on Sunday, Nov. 22, and will include the closure of Trancas Canyon Park, which is closed during all Red Flag Warnings.

“A combination of strong winds, low relative humidity, and warm temperatures creates an extreme fire danger for Los Angeles and Ventura Counties, including the Santa Monica Mountains National Recreation Area,” read an alert issued by the City of Malibu.

The National Weather Service (NWS) provided more information about the weather expected over the weekend.

“The strongest winds are expected late tonight [Thursday] through Saturday morning … but moderate northeast winds will likely persist through much of the day Sunday,” the NWS reported.
